The Bilstein is a good basic set-up and I have about 22K miles on mine. Ride is good and the performance is good as well. For those who simply want a lowered stance and slightly improved handling, it is a modest $800 to put into the car.

The Teins with the EDFC is the better of the ways to go IMO. So much more you can achieve with them that after about 8K on the Eibach/Bilstein, I had made my decision. That's throwing $$ away when it could have been done right the first time. (At least to my desires.)

$1,200 for the CS's, $350 for the EDFC and figure ~$500 for the install and wiring. It's some $$ but I have yet to hear anyone disliking this set-up for a spring/strut. Read all the posts in the GS suspension forum.

If you really want it to be low, AirRunner.

It's your car so you have to make the decision which suits you.

Just to note on the L-Sportline package, the Bilsteins in that had 3 snap ring settings where the book replacement Bilstein has 2 settings. You'll get an aditional 3/8" of lowering with that strut. (or were there four settings?)
